Full title reads: "Roosevelt Nominated For Third Term".
Chicago, Illinois, United States of America (USA).
VS of the nomination of Franklin D Roosevelt at the Democratic national convention. His name is put forward in speeches by Senator Hill and Jim Farley who concedes his own position and calls for a unanimous vote for Roosevelt by a shout of Aye or No, Roosevelt is therefore selected.
CU Roosevelt speaking, he talks of the plans he had to retire to private life on January 1941 but of how these plans had to be forgotten because of the dangerous situation and he talks of the need for all private plans to be forgotten in the face of the demand for people to serve the state. He states that the situation requires him to serve again and if he is called to serve again by the vote of the people he will do so.
